Local shells

ezTerm can also open local shells — a Windows cmd, PowerShell, pwsh, or any absolute path to an executable.

  1. New session → Local.
  2. Pick a preset (cmd, powershell, pwsh) or browse to a custom path.
  3. (Optional) set a starting directory.
  4. Save and connect.

The shell runs in a ConPTY just like WSL sessions, so colours and ANSI escapes work normally.

For users who want everything in one window — local PowerShell, a WSL distro, and a remote SSH session as sibling tabs.
